Seventy City and contractor crews continue plowing emergency snow routes and arterial streets, and treating roads with granular salt pre-wet with brine. Crews will continue working throughout the evening until Tuesday.
Crews report that arterial and residential streets vary from slush to snow-covered and snow packed, creating slick areas. The National Weather Service has issued a Blizzard Warning that remains in effect until 6 p.m. today. High winds and blowing snow are creating whiteout conditions, making travel dangerous. Up to two more inches of snow are expected.
Drivers are urged to use extreme caution. Be alert for deteriorating weather conditions creating slick areas on streets and sidewalks. Please avoid convenience trips and leave extra space between yourself and other drivers. And remember to give road crews plenty of room to work.
